How menopause affects runners

  • Knee, hip & low back pain

  • Reduced balance & confidence on uneven terrain

  • Changing gait, feeling less agile and bouncy and more ‘ploddy’

  • Slower pace

  • Find uphills harder and downhills even worse

  • Weight gain or unable to lose weight despite being active

The great news is that all these issues can be addressed with changes to training and nutrition.
